Plug the PS5 controller in using a USB-C cable. Press the “PlayStation” logo button to power the controller on. If it’s recognized, sign in. Try a different USB-C cable.

Unfortunately, if you buy a DualSense controller and do not own a PS5, the controller doesn’t come with a charging cable. But you can buy a USB-C to USB-A cable from Amazon.
